public class TaskDataExternalizer {
/**
* Replaces the first 38 bytes of a an input stream with an XML 1.1 header.
*/
public static class Xml11InputStream extends FilterInputStream {
/**
* XML 1.1 header.
*/
byte[] header;
/**
* Current position in {@link #header}.
*/
int pointer;
public Xml11InputStream(InputStream in) throws IOException {
super(in);
header = new String("<?xml version=\"1.1\" encoding=\"UTF-8\"?>").getBytes("US-ASCII"); //$NON-NLS-1$ //$NON-NLS-2$
}
@Override
public synchronized void reset() throws IOException {
throw new IOException();
}
@Override
public synchronized void mark(int readlimit) {
}
@Override
public boolean markSupported() {
return false;
}
@Override
public int read(byte[] b, int off, int len) throws IOException {
// fill b with bytes from header until the header has been read
if (pointer < header.length) {
int read = 0;
for (; pointer < header.length && read < len; read++, pointer++) {
b[off + read] = header[pointer];
readByte();
}
return read;
} else {
return super.read(b, off, len);
}
}
/**
* Advances the underlying stream by a single byte.
*/
private void readByte() throws IOException, EOFException {
if (in.read() == -1) {
throw new EOFException();
}
}
@Override
public int read() throws IOException {
if (pointer < header.length) {
readByte();
return header[pointer++];
} else {
return super.read();
}
}
@Override
public long skip(long n) throws IOException {
if (pointer < header.length) {
// skip at most the number of bytes remaining in the header
long skip = Math.min(header.length - pointer, n);
// never skip more bytes than underlying stream
skip = super.skip(skip);
pointer += skip;
return skip;
} else {
return super.skip(n);
}
}
}
